SARASOTA BECOMES FILM SET;
TRAFFIC DELAYS EXPECTED

Sarasota, FL: The City of Sarasota is coordinating with Sanborn Entertainment, a new Sarasota County based television production company, to facilitate filming a portion of a TV pilot over the weekend. Motorists and pedestrians should expect intermittent traffic delays from U.S. 41 and the John Ringling Causeway to the Bird Key/Coon Key Bridge. Message boards will be posted alerting drivers to the delays. "We're very excited the City of Sarasota was selected for this shoot," said Deputy City Manager Marlon Brown. "It will cause some brief driving inconveniences. But, we're working with the production crew to minimize traffic congestion, while ensuring they're able to film."

Just three weeks ago, Sanborn Entertainment announced its collaboration with Sarasota County to bring a television production studio to the area along with 117 jobs over the next three years.
